Transaction e633f3424f10bd76ba17aabb08761b709d6588725d8fe328cd2460a3e395fa04
1 Input
1 Output
-
e633f3424f10bd76ba17aabb08761b709d6588725d8fe328cd2460a3e395fa04:0
- value
- 10371
- script pubkey
- OP_0 OP_PUSHBYTES_20 1379b870ad7559081676f9144daba0a36886c596
- address
- bc1qzdumsu9dw4vss9nkly2ym2aq5d5gd3vkg597kw